In our outpatient community "at the water tower" of care can people who because of their disease can not live alone in their own homes, but live in a private setting. The focus of the WG is the common everyday life activities. In outpatient residential communities, the patients live until her death in an environment that provides safety and security, offers the greatest possible independence and promotes their abilities. We are convinced that such a residential community can also be a good alternative to residential care.
